Emma Gilsenan
Psychologist
| ADULTS |
Emma is a registered psychologist who works with adults. Her approach integrates various therapeutic modalities to help people to increase self-understanding, befriend their inner critic, and live authentically.
Emma enjoys working with neurodivergent people and people who are questioning if this description could be a good fit for them. She often works with people with highly masked autism, and those who are highly sensitive, self-aware, and high-achieving yet may be experiencing ongoing distress in their relationships with others and/or themselves.
Emma also has interest in assisting people with issues related to sexuality, gender, and relationship difficulties, and is an ally to LGBTQIA+, kink, sex work, and diverse relationships.
In sessions, Emma takes a neuroaffirming, non-judgemental, curiosity-led approach. She provides a space for safe and expansive discussion to support people to explore and understand their authentic self and the relationships and structures they live within.
